Administration to seek new sites to rehabilitate disaster affected families

Tuesday, 22 AUGUST 2023 | PNS | DEHRADUN

Considering the findings of a report of the geological survey of Vikasnagar’s Jakhan village conducted following a massive landslide last week, the Dehradun district administration will soon start finding new locations to rehabilitate the affected families. The survey report has revealed that the site where are least 10 houses collapsed in the landslide is no longer safe for habitation. Considering this, the administration will soon find new locations to rehabilitate about 20 affected families that include about 150 people, said the district magistrate Sonika. A geological team surveyed the area on Friday to learn about the safety of the area regarding rehabilitation that submitted a report to the district administration on Sunday. According to the report, several geomorphological features were found near the site, indicating a tectonically active area that can cause subsidence there. The DM said that the administration received the report on Sunday and will soon start finding new locations to rehabilitate the affected families. She said, “The whole process from finding a suitable location to rehabilitate affected families will take at least four to six months. We will choose locations where geological surveys will also be conducted to establish the safety of the area. Sometimes the affected families do not like the location and refuse to relocate to the chosen area. This takes a considerable amount of time but the administration will try to relocate the families as soon as possible. Till then, they will be provided with all possible assistance.”
